C#连接oracle数据库的问题

 我来答
rbfjiool
2013-12-20 · 超过46用户采纳过TA的回答
知道答主
回答量:99
采纳率:0%
帮助的人:109万
展开全部
cmd.CommandText = v_sql;try{if (cmd.ExecuteNonQuery() == 0){MessageBox.Show("您的用户名或密码不正确! ");}else{MessageBox.Show("欢迎使用! ");}}catch{MessageBox.Show( "数据库没链接上吗? ");}finally{conn.Close();}}private void cancel_button_Click(object sender, EventArgs e){Application.ExitThread();}}}总是提示连接不上 请各位帮忙看看谢谢啊! 补充: 我在ODBC的系統DSN裡的驅動程序oracle in orahome92 裡面Data Source Name 為 nes TNS Service Name 為 NES(這是我在oracle裡配的) 在Test connection 裡測試是成功的 补充: 我在ODBC裡DSN中配添加ORCALE ORAHOME92, DATA SOURCE NAME 為 nes TNS SERVER NAME 為 nes 在TEST CONNECTION 中的USER NAME 為 nes PASSWORD 為 nes 測試是通過的 补充: 异常是 找不到表或视图 我建了一个数据库叫nes 同时建立了一个表空间也是nes 用户名叫 nes 密码nes 在表空间了建立了一个表叫 login_table 然后在C#里建立了一个登录界面 在odbc里面按照上面的方式配置,运行是就提示异常 补充: 我应用oracle建立了一个数据库叫nes, 建立表空间 nes 用户nes(dba权限) 在表空间内建立 表login_table,(v_name ,v_pw ) 应用C#制作登录界面 如上,采用把catch后边加上(Exception ex)把MessageBox.Show();里边改成ex.Message然后运行,异常是ora-00942表或视图不存在
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式